to cover. We have a lot to cover. So let's get into this headline of the week. ah The big thing that happened in these past two weeks was the big Xbox layoff and restructure. So let's go through all the details. First, they weren't mass layoffs at Xbox on July 6th. Sixteen hundred staff were laid off. And over the next fiscal year, 1600 more are set to be cut.
00:13:13
Speaker
yeah Four studios are leaving Xbox, but they are not being shut down, which is actually a big pro that came out of this. Compulsion Games, who produced games like South of Midnight and Double Fine Productions, who gave us Psychonauts. Those are both independent studios once again.
00:13:32
Speaker
Ninja Theory, who are the developers behind the Senua games and Undead Labs, who are currently working on State of Decay 3, are being acquired by new owners. It will not be under Xbox anymore, you just under new owners. I don't know who the owners are, though. I don't know if it's been told who's been now owning them, but ah they're still here.
00:13:55
Speaker
And lastly, Arkane Studios is, quote, beginning required consultations with its work council to review potential strategic options, end quote.
00:14:07
Speaker
I don't know how far along that has gone yet. I believe there's ah also rumors that Arkane might just get rebought by Xbox. But, like, we don't know what the whole situation with Arkane is right now. They're the most, like...
00:14:18
Speaker
Who knows what's going to go happen to them? They might go independent. They might not. We don't know what's going to happen with Arkane entirely yet. Asha Sharma noted that there will also be changes at Activision, Bethesda, ZeniMax, Blizzard, King, Mojang and Xbox Game Studios that will vary in size. Bethesda and ZeniMax specifically had 440 cuts to their workforce. This, however, is leading to a strike as they're part of a union, and that has led to rallies already.
00:14:53
Speaker
id Software has had 136 employees cut. the However, the studio did say that they're doing, they're okay. The size of the studio is now back to about as many employees they had when they made the first Doom, Doom 2016.
00:15:10
Speaker
Mojang and King, and for those who don't know who King is, they're the people behind Candy Crush Saga, which I didn't even know Xbox owned, but they do. They now report directly to Asha, and they are ah obviously the largest platforms by monthly active players because...
00:15:28
Speaker
parents in that candy crush song got my god like they're on level a thousand by now like it's crazy see a lot of uh a lot of the roles that are being cut are management roles uh and it's also they're cutting down their chain of command as it turns out there were like times when there were like 14 people in like a chain of command ladder just to get things approved they are changing that to like if at most there will be three to five which is I actually didn't know that. That's great.
00:15:59
Speaker
Yes. And lastly, he ah Helen Chiang has been promoted to COO with end-to-end P&L responsibility across content, hardware, platform, and services. Moving on this week in gaming history, July 20th to August 2nd. Here's some stuff that happened in the past. Starting off July 20th, 2005, the aszuret Entertainment Software Rating Board, the ESRB, re-rates the video game Grand Theft Auto San Andreas from mature to adults only.
02:02:44
Speaker
July 28th, 2017, Nintendo launched the 2DS XL in the U.S. priced at $150.
02:02:52
Speaker
wow August 1st, 1994, a federal district jury in New York awards 208 million us doll USD in damages to Alpex Computer, fining Nintendo guilty of infringement of an early video game patent held by Alpex.
